ANALYSIS
Danny Tims is a bantamweight prospect who's made his name known fighting on the Midwest MMA circuit. In the past Tims has fought as high as lightweight, and did have a strong amateur career (18-2) before making the decision to turn pro. Tims' big break came in 2010 when he defeated Brian Davison at Bellator 16 which earned him some well needed exposure and a spot in Bellator's season three bantamweight tournament.
Tims is a speedy fighter who shows good quickness on his feet. He's a confident and unorthodox striker who has a habit of keeping his hands very low and diving in from the outside with his punches. Tims throws quick spinning back fists and high kicks. He's proven to be a tough fighter who doesn't wilt when he's hit, and he can take a hit without getting put off his game. Tims overall standup is still green and he'll need to work on both his offensive and defensive abilities. His habit of keeping his guard down and hands low has seen him get dropped badly, and Tims' head movement and defensive striking games will require work. Offensively, Tims' arsenal is still quite basic and he'd be well served by expanding his repertoire. Although Tims' striking is still raw, the development he's shown since his initial start has been encouraging as he's continued making progress in his standup game.
Danny's a competent wrestler who does have a high school background from William Chrisman High School (Independence, Missouri). Tims is very active and unconventional with his takedown attempts, shooting in from odd angles to try and take his opponent down. A relentless wrestler, Tims goes all-out with every attempt and is armed with a quick shot, nice single and double leg takedowns, and good inside and outside leg trips. On the ground Tims possesses a controlled top game staying very tight to his opponent and utilizing an active, if not overpowering ground and pound game. Technically his ground game is sound as Tims will work for his submissions, at times sacrificing positioning in order to try and finish the fight. He also shows good submission defense and normally fights with good composure on the mat. Occasionally Tims will become content with sitting in his opponents guard and could benefit from fighting more actively from top position as well as off his back.

OUTLOOK
Danny Tims is a young bantamweight who's shown composure and promise in his wrestling/ground games. He's quick, tough and by all accounts is taking his career very seriously. Although he still has a lot to prove, Tims has plenty of time to sharpen his skills and continue progressing as a fighter. There's work to be done but Danny Tims does have top twenty potential.
